Cerrado de Juan Raja
Cerrado de Juan Raja is a locality in Vinuesa, Soria, Castile and León. Cerrado de Juan Raja is situated nearby to the locality Fuente del Hornillo, as well as near Fuente del Ortigal.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Vinuesa is a municipality located in the province of Soria, in the autonomous community of Castile and León, Spain. According to the 2004 census, the municipality had a population of 1,031 inhabitants.

Salduero is a municipality located in the province of Soria, Castile and León, Spain. According to the 2004 census, the municipality had a population of 193 inhabitants. Salduero is situated 4 km south of Cerrado de Juan Raja.

Molinos de Duero is a municipality located in the province of Soria, Castile and León, Spain. According to the 2004 census, the municipality had a population of 185 inhabitants. Molinos de Duero is situated 4½ km south of Cerrado de Juan Raja.
